The US Customary Units vs. the British Imperial System

how many cups is 64 oz

Source: Adobe Stock

Although the US customary and imperial systems are very similar in terms of length, area, and weight, they differ greatly in volume measurements. Here is a comparison of both systems:

  • 1 US fl oz = 29.573 ml
  • 1 imperial fl oz = 28.412 ml
  • 1 US pint = 473.176 ml
  • 1 imperial pint = 568.261 ml
  • 1 US quart = 946.353 ml
  • 1 imperial quart = 1,130.52 ml 
  • 1 US gallon = 3,785.41 ml
  • 1 imperial gallon = 4,546.09 ml

Fluid ounce in the US customary system is more liquid than in the UK imperial system.

How Many Cups Is 64 Oz?

To convert a measurement from fluid ounces into cups, multiply the number of fluid ounces by the conversion factor. This will give you an answer in cups. 

For example, say that you want to figure out how many cups there are to 64 fluid ounces. If we dial up 0.125 and multiply it with 64 fl oz underneath, we will get how many cups:

  • 64 Fluid Ounces x 0.125 = 8 Cups
  • As a result, 64 Fluid Ounces equals 8 cups.

A Quarter Cup Equals How Many Tablespoons?

The one-quarter cup includes 4 tablespoons, and every tablespoon contains 3 teaspoons; hence, a quarter cup contains 12 teaspoons. 2 fluid ounces is the same as a quarter cup.
